Across the globe, countless individuals grapple with the weight of mental health battles and the agonizing grip of unresolved trauma. Astonishingly, a significant number remain oblivious to their internal struggles. Nonetheless, each day witnesses new revelations—people recognizing the echoes of repetitive childhood trauma that have shaped their lives, leading to CPTSD. This pivotal moment marks the outset of their arduous healing journey.
In addition, I touch upon a crucial point: the imperative for men to break free from the shackles of stoicism—the notion that men should conceal their emotions and vulnerabilities. To truly mend from our wounds and traumas, we must shed our fear, embrace vulnerability, and unhesitatingly seek assistance—something we undeniably deserve.
